Starting with this release, all Cratchware services build on the minimal `slimcore` base instead of the full distro image. This cuts typical image size by roughly 60% and shrinks the CVE surface considerably, but it also removes the shell, package manager, and debug utilities from production images. Teams that relied on exec-ing into containers must switch to the ephemeral debug sidecar. Build args and cache behavior changed accordingly; please verify pipelines before promoting. The new default build configuration follows.

deployment values, bawef-bagep:
ULAIX_PIN=3809
ULAIX_METRICS_HOST=metrics.ulaix.zemvarlabs.internal
ULAIX_LOG_LEVEL=error
ULAIX_TENANT=novael

## FAQ: Why is the Quillfinder autocomplete index slow this week?

The Quillfinder autocomplete index is mid-rebuild after we migrated suggestion shards to the Bryncote cluster. Query latency is up roughly 3x and will stay elevated until the rebuild finishes, likely Thursday. No action needed from feature teams; the scheduler throttles itself during business hours. If the rebuild stalls, on-call can resume it from the admin shell, which requires unlocking the index vault. For the sync notes, the vault's recovery passphrase follows.

strongbox words: zorath-holmir

Meeting notes — Storage team onboarding session

We walked through the cold storage archiving process for the Permafrost buckets. Buckets untouched for 180 days get flagged, reviewed, and moved to deep archive tier on the first Monday of each month. New team members should not run the archive script manually; it is scheduled and audited. Any exceptions or restores go through a single approver, who also owns the runbook. That owner is named below.

named custodian: Belius Casath Ulaix Sorius